Description
BBBSMB's mission is to provide children who lack positive adult role models with strong and enduring, professionally supported one-to-one relationships with caring, responsible adults that change their lives for the better, forever.

Program areas at BBBSMB

Community based mentoring programs: our core program matches a volunteer Big brother or sister with a child who could benefit from a one-to-one relationship with a caring adult. Bigs and littles meet a few times per month, for a couple of hours each time, at places and times convenient to both. School based mentoring programs: volunteer Big Brothers and Sisters matched in our school-based program meet their little Brothers or Sisters at school, a few times a month over the course of the academic year.
